Wausau (AUW) to Washington (IAD) Flight Distance

The flight distance from Wausau Downtown Airport (AUW) in Wausau, United States to Washington Dulles International Airport (IAD) in Washington, United States is 1,205 kilometers (749 miles / 651 nautical miles). The estimated flight time for this route is approximately 2h, flying east southeast at a heading of 120°.

This is a short-haul route typically served by narrow-body aircraft such as the Boeing 737 or Airbus A320 family. In-flight service is usually limited to drinks and light snacks.

This is a domestic route within United States. Both airports operate in the same country, which may simplify travel requirements and documentation. Despite being a domestic route, there is a 1-hour time difference between the two cities.

Time zone information: When it's 08:08 in Wausau, it's 09:08 in Washington.

The return flight from Washington (IAD) to Wausau (AUW) follows a heading of 308° (northwest). Actual flight times may vary depending on wind conditions, air traffic, and the specific aircraft used.
